Research shows that the level of physician selfreported fear of malpractice liability is positively associated with objective measures of the riskiness of the state liability environment, including the number of paid malpractice claims per physician, average malpractice premium, and various types of tort reforms 20 However, studies in this review that tested for associations between self-reported liability concern and imaging decisions found mixed results 5,131415. Further, current evidence is largely built on physicians in high-risk specialties, such as ED physicians and radiologists 5; the impact of defensive medicine on primary care physicians has not been examined. One explanation for this mixed evidence is that physicians might perceive a higher level of liability concern than the true risk of being sued. Terry DVM, MS, Diplomate ACVS, Owner - Azzore To determine if someone is liable - that is, legally responsible, for your injuries, you need to figure out if a health care provider was negligent and if so, whether that negligence caused your injury. Just because your case turned out poorly doesn't necessarily mean that a doctor was negligent. The key factors in determining negligence are the accepted standard of care, whether that standard was followed and, if not, whether not following that standard caused the injury.

9 receipt of collateral benefits is deemed irrelevant and immaterial on the issue of damages, is not to be disclosed to the jury, and is not a reason to deduct anything from plaintiff s special damages. Id. at 109. But, effective April 11, 2003, the General Assembly abrogated this common law rule of damages, enacting 2323.41. Under this statute, collateral source information may be admitted into evidence, provided that the collateral payor is not subrogated. Aside from statutory tort reform, the Ohio Supreme Court s decision in Robinson v. Bates, 112 Ohio St.3d 17 (2006), held that, under Ohio common law, an original medical bill rendered and the amount accepted in full payment are admissible to prove the reasonableness and necessity of charges rendered for medical and hospital care. Id. at syllabus, 1. As a consequence of the passage of statutory collateral source rules for general tort cases, Ohio Rev. Code 2315.20, and for medical malpractice cases, Ohio Rev. Code 2323.41, there is considerable uncertainty regarding the continuing validity of the Robinson case. Only one appellate court is known to have considered the question. See Jaques v. Manton, 2009-Ohio-1468 (6 Dist. 2009) (Robinson found to have no continuing application in general tort cases). Two Franklin County Common Pleas Court judges have issued decisions on the question. (Appendix D and E). There is a move afoot in the legislature to overturn Robinson, at least insofar as precluding its continuing validity. Medical Malpractice Case Investigation, Evaluation, And Preparation Interviewing The Prospective Plaintiff The opportunity to select a client begins with the first phone call. At that time we attempt to obtain as much information as possible to enable us to determine whether it is worth the additional time and effort to schedule the client for a meeting in our office. Accordingly, regardless of whether we interview the client over the phone or a member of our staff does so, we have a checklist of pertinent information to elicit at the time of the initial call. To insure that such information is provided to us in the event we are not available to take the call, we provide our staff with a form (Appendix F) to enable them to determine what questions are significant to our evaluation of the merits of the claim. Suicide is the ninth leading cause of death in the United States with an incidence of approximately 12 per 100,000 per year. The ratio of men to women is 3:1, although women attempt it more frequently. The ratio of white to black is 2:1. The highest rate is in elderly white men living alone. While courts and juries recognize that psychological states cannot be calibrated with precision, they vary widely in their opinions as to when a suicide is reasonably foreseeable. That misplaced idealism was shared by the President, who had projected $1,000,000,000 in savings from increased VA efficiency as part of a total $91,000,000,000 in savings (later pared down to $58,000,000,000) under his proposed national health plan. The President's estimates were blown out of the water in January, 1994, by the Congressional Budget Office's official estimates for the Clinton plan. They showed zero savings and an increase of more than $74,000,000,000 in the Federal deficit over the next five years, and an increase of $126,000,000,000 by 2004.
